Atlanta's Cary Street Partners Aligns with Rogerscasey

RICHMOND, Virginia – Cary Street Partners LLC, a leading full service wealth management and investment banking firm, announced today the selection of Rogerscasey to provide research consulting services for its Wealth Management Division.  

As a component of Cary Street Partners’ open architecture platform, Rogerscasey’s  research services will further enhance Cary Street Partners’ wealth management service offerings to clients by providing market strategy solutions, economic assessments and a customized model of alternatives managers to meet Cary Street Partners’ specific client needs.  

“The relationship between our firm and Rogerscasey is a natural extension of our growing wealth management platform and our ability to provide exceptional, customized financial solutions to our valued clients,” noted Kip Caffey, managing partner of Cary Street Partners.  “I am particularly excited about the strength and breadth that Rogerscasey has in alternative investments, an area of interest for our clients.  I feel confident that Rogerscasey’s research will provide our financial advisors with the valuable supplementary tools needed to provide our clients with a deeper level of innovative, client-driven advice while positioning our firm for continued growth.”

About Cary Street Partners:

Cary Street Partners (www.carystreetpartners.com) is a full service wealth management and investment banking firm headquartered in Richmond, Virginia with offices in Virginia, North Carolina, Georgia, Tennessee and Texas.  The firm provides objective wealth management and investment banking solutions to successful individuals, institutions and companies.  The Wealth Management division provides financial advice to individuals, family offices and nonprofit institutions, including financial planning, manager recommendations and portfolio construction and maintenance. The investment banking team provides merger and acquisition advisory services, private placements of debt and equity capital, and strategic advice to emerging growth companies in select industries in the Southeast. Cary Street Partners is the trade name used by two separate limited liability companies, Cary Street Partners Investment Advisory LLC, a registered investment advisor; and Cary Street Partners LLC, a registered broker-dealer and member of FINRA and SIPC.

Segal Rogerscasey (www.segalrc.com) a member of The Segal Group, is a leading global investment solutions firm that provides innovative, client-driven consulting advice and outsourcing solutions.  The firm has been in operation for more than 45 years and is one of the largest U.S.-based investment consultants.  Clients include corporations, nonprofit organizations, endowments, foundations, state and local governments and joint boards of trustees administering benefits plans under the Taft-Hartley Act.  The firm works with financial intermediaries through Rogerscasey, a Division of SegalAdvisors, and with Canadian clients through Segal Rogerscasey Canada.
